Looking down the 70 steps towards the Dougie and the bottom of Brock Mill Lane. The cottages are still inhabited. Photo taken early spring 1964.

Comment by: frank a on 16th December 2009 at 16:08

Gina You can either go down Leylnd Mill Lane and follow the Douggie or go up Green Hill towards Boars Head and look for an opening on the right hand side, which leads to the top of the steps. The area near the bottom of the steps is now a housing estate. Close by there is a house of the Haigh estate with initials EB( Earl of Balcarasse)
